Transaction 51780c261720c91e80a66d7b3826777960fd3c1dc3a9e7e824af346268d6dc9c

1 Input
2 Outputs
  • 51780c261720c91e80a66d7b3826777960fd3c1dc3a9e7e824af346268d6dc9c:0
  • value  314499600
    address  3EwnDVFPuHNvdPnUUmr6eYGSVCZkSmgYFp
  • 51780c261720c91e80a66d7b3826777960fd3c1dc3a9e7e824af346268d6dc9c:1
  • value  3520719
    address  1oCjVTSCmgJAaeb8jGtamyreMzVNtXrap